范例:使用for循环实现1 ~ 100数据累加 # coding:UTF-8sum = 0 # 定义变量保存计算总和# 生成的最大数据为100,范围:0 - 100for num in range(101): # 遍历100次sum += num # 数据累...
01-08 928
斐波那契属于递推算法吗 |
斐波那契数列的递推公式,python斐波那契数列for循环
∪ω∪ 斐波那契数列的递推公式可以表示为:F(n)F(n-1)F(n-2)。斐波那契数列是一个非常著名的数列,由意大利数学家斐波那契(Leonardo Fibonacci)在《计算之书》斐波那契数列是指以下数列:1、1、2、3、5、8、13、21、34、55、89、……这个数列的第一项和第二项都是1,从第三项开始,每一项都是前两项的和。斐波那契数列以其独特的递推关
一、斐波那契数列所谓斐波那契数列,是指【当前项】的值等于【前两项】之和的数列:该数列有递推公式如下:T ( n ) = { 1 ( n = 0 ) 1 ( n = 1 ) T ( n − 1 )通过公式,我们可以在O(1)的时间内得到F(n)。但公式中引入了无理数,所以不能保证结果的精度。解法四:分治策略注意到斐波那契数列是二阶递推数列,所以存在一个2*2的矩阵A,使得:我
在数学上,斐波那契数列以如下被以递推的方法定义:F(0)=0,F(1)=1, F(n)=F(n - 1)+F(n - 2)(n ≥ 2,n ∈ N*)在现代物理、准晶体结构、化学等领域,斐波纳契数列都有直接的应用,为此,美凭借一个动画,快速理解“等差数列”求和_哔哩哔哩_bilibili 【硬核高中数学】数列2 等差数列:等差数列的递推公式【硬核高中数学】数列2 等差数列:等差数列的
这个数列是意大利中世纪数学家斐波那契(Fibonacci,1170—1250)在《算盘全书》中提出的我们称这个数列为斐波那契数列。二、斐波那契数列的通项及其递推公式如果设n F 为该数列的第n 项()n N +∈ Fibonacci数列的递推公式为:Fn=Fn-1+Fn-2,其中F1=F2=1。当n比较大时,Fn也非常大,现在我们想知道,Fn除以10007的余数是多少。直接来程序:n=int(input())deffbn
后台-插件-广告管理-内容页尾部广告(手机) |
相关文章
范例:使用for循环实现1 ~ 100数据累加 # coding:UTF-8sum = 0 # 定义变量保存计算总和# 生成的最大数据为100,范围:0 - 100for num in range(101): # 遍历100次sum += num # 数据累...
01-08 928
要求第n项斐波那契数列的值不难发现一个规律: 当n=1的时候对应的值是1 当n=2的时候对应的值是1 当n>2的时候对应的值等于前两项的和。 编程思路 # 创建一个带参数的函数,返回对应的...
01-08 928
在C语言中,统计数字可以有多种方式。下面我将从不同的角度给出一些常见的方法。 1. 统计整数个数: 方法一,使用循环遍历数组或输入的数字序列,每次遇到一个整数就计数器加1。 ...
01-08 928
发表评论
评论列表